I just discovered I pulled out a bottle of juice that has a use by date of 1/29/11. It produces nice vapor, has decent TH, and tastes good. So what actually happens with expired juice? Does the nicotine level drop? Should I through it away?

That is only 3 months old. Some vendors put an expirations date of around 2 years on their juice bottles. I'd say you are just fine. Some of my BackwoodBrew juice I let "steep" for 2-3 months before I even start to use it. But that's only cuz I already have a nice supply of available juice to use while I let my new orders steep awhile.

I cant agree with Years, pg has a shelf life of 2yrs VG 1.5, its the additives to the Nic juice that go bad more so than the Nic itself, "YEARS" no way I mean cmon years, I just cant and wouldn't vape juice that is years old, I have purchased and stored lots of juice in my vaping time and now I don't even want juice that's more then 7-8 months old anymore and much rather would be vaping fresh juice then stuff that is years old, besides when juice does go bad believe me you will know it, been there done that,, it has one foul taste to it once it turns ! just my opinion of course guys but I have had some juice that has turned in as little as 8 months and others that has turned in a year, and then have had some that lasted almost 2 but I wouldn't vape it at that point. Even if you buy 100mg Nic juice max shelf life is 2 yrs posted on the bottle.

Agreed, I read where FSUSA is going to sell premium juice that is aged at least 6 mo or more. If it tastes good, I say vape it

I still have juice from august of last year...damn it's good. I also have 100mg in deep freeze storage that according to the chem people on ECF will last longer than 2 years. If it's good, vape it. If it tastes nasty, chuck it.
